git: 34d98d7fdbed - main - www/freenginx-devel: third-party modules management (+)
- Go to: [ bottom of page ] [ top of archives ] [ this month ]
Date: Fri, 30 Jan 2026 18:51:14 UTC
The branch main has been updated by osa:
URL: https://cgit.FreeBSD.org/ports/commit/?id=34d98d7fdbede49e49d51570ae309c25c6189ada
commit 34d98d7fdbede49e49d51570ae309c25c6189ada
Author: Sergey A. Osokin <osa@FreeBSD.org>
AuthorDate: 2026-01-30 18:50:17 +0000
Commit: Sergey A. Osokin <osa@FreeBSD.org>
CommitDate: 2026-01-30 18:51:05 +0000
www/freenginx-devel: third-party modules management (+)
- update xss module its recent snapshot
- remove a needless patch
Bump PORTREVISION.
Sponsored by: tipi.work
---
www/freenginx-devel/Makefile | 2 +-
www/freenginx-devel/Makefile.extmod | 3 +--
www/freenginx-devel/distinfo | 6 +++---
.../files/extra-patch-xss-nginx-module-config | 15 ---------------
4 files changed, 5 insertions(+), 21 deletions(-)
diff --git a/www/freenginx-devel/Makefile b/www/freenginx-devel/Makefile
index 11704c60955f..3d910beed2a3 100644
--- a/www/freenginx-devel/Makefile
+++ b/www/freenginx-devel/Makefile
@@ -1,7 +1,7 @@
PORTNAME= freenginx
PORTVERSION= ${NGINX_VERSION}
.include "version.mk"
-PORTREVISION= 14
+PORTREVISION= 15
CATEGORIES= www
MASTER_SITES= https://freenginx.org/download/ \
LOCAL/osa
diff --git a/www/freenginx-devel/Makefile.extmod b/www/freenginx-devel/Makefile.extmod
index 3dd5a7f1dbe5..ed0417e84a1d 100644
--- a/www/freenginx-devel/Makefile.extmod
+++ b/www/freenginx-devel/Makefile.extmod
@@ -321,8 +321,7 @@ VOD_VARS= DSO_EXTMODS+=vod
VTS_GH_TUPLE= vozlt:nginx-module-vts:37d319f:vts
VTS_VARS= DSO_EXTMODS+=vts
-XSS_GH_TUPLE= openresty:xss-nginx-module:de2d87a:xss
-XSS_EXTRA_PATCHES= ${PATCHDIR}/extra-patch-xss-nginx-module-config
+XSS_GH_TUPLE= openresty:xss-nginx-module:0e77f38:xss
XSS_VARS= DSO_EXTMODS+=xss
WEBSOCKIFY_GH_TUPLE= tg123:websockify-nginx-module:c11bc9a:websockify
diff --git a/www/freenginx-devel/distinfo b/www/freenginx-devel/distinfo
index 1614044511b7..1988acf61f8c 100644
--- a/www/freenginx-devel/distinfo
+++ b/www/freenginx-devel/distinfo
@@ -1,4 +1,4 @@
-TIMESTAMP = 1768855877
+TIMESTAMP = 1769798898
SHA256 (freenginx-1.29.4.tar.gz) = 51a596451e334b51ce8cef1291b576ed601ed557e1b500e6c1a77a469d603e27
SIZE (freenginx-1.29.4.tar.gz) = 1249883
SHA256 (nginx_mogilefs_module-1.0.4.tar.gz) = 7ac230d30907f013dff8d435a118619ea6168aa3714dba62c6962d350c6295ae
@@ -141,7 +141,7 @@ SHA256 (vozlt-nginx-module-vts-37d319f_GH0.tar.gz) = 9ffe9ac5cd3716bb12832926bb7
SIZE (vozlt-nginx-module-vts-37d319f_GH0.tar.gz) = 185334
SHA256 (tg123-websockify-nginx-module-c11bc9a_GH0.tar.gz) = aca454bffcee2476dc92682ebfb8c0378a271fda178be7e945d648419d220758
SIZE (tg123-websockify-nginx-module-c11bc9a_GH0.tar.gz) = 14646
-SHA256 (openresty-xss-nginx-module-de2d87a_GH0.tar.gz) = f830c9300d751046e2592c74d09f39ac4b4b4567078c96c24951de5554861b5e
-SIZE (openresty-xss-nginx-module-de2d87a_GH0.tar.gz) = 12779
+SHA256 (openresty-xss-nginx-module-0e77f38_GH0.tar.gz) = 837d403885d90a3456d25b72ebd3ce40ec93dd8208ac482b587aa05703cb425f
+SIZE (openresty-xss-nginx-module-0e77f38_GH0.tar.gz) = 12923
SHA256 (tokers-zstd-nginx-module-f4ba115_GH0.tar.gz) = 20045e8ac80e2cc9fd3659573153cb1f22d98a653a10fe939a4be0e90160826a
SIZE (tokers-zstd-nginx-module-f4ba115_GH0.tar.gz) = 55848
diff --git a/www/freenginx-devel/files/extra-patch-xss-nginx-module-config b/www/freenginx-devel/files/extra-patch-xss-nginx-module-config
deleted file mode 100644
index e341b4c5a020..000000000000
--- a/www/freenginx-devel/files/extra-patch-xss-nginx-module-config
+++ /dev/null
@@ -1,15 +0,0 @@
---- ../xss-nginx-module-de2d87a/config.orig 2020-04-24 17:13:57.596040000 -0400
-+++ ../xss-nginx-module-de2d87a/config 2020-04-24 17:18:16.438437000 -0400
-@@ -1,5 +1,9 @@
- ngx_addon_name=ngx_http_xss_filter_module
--HTTP_AUX_FILTER_MODULES="$HTTP_AUX_FILTER_MODULES ngx_http_xss_filter_module"
--NGX_ADDON_SRCS="$NGX_ADDON_SRCS $ngx_addon_dir/src/ngx_http_xss_filter_module.c $ngx_addon_dir/src/ngx_http_xss_util.c"
--NGX_ADDON_DEPS="$NGX_ADDON_DEPS $ngx_addon_dir/src/ddebug.h $ngx_addon_dir/src/ngx_http_xss_filter_module.h $ngx_addon_dir/src/ngx_http_xss_util.h"
-
-+ngx_module_name="$ngx_addon_name"
-+ngx_module_type=HTTP_FILTER
-+
-+ngx_module_srcs="$ngx_addon_dir/src/ngx_http_xss_filter_module.c $ngx_addon_dir/src/ngx_http_xss_util.c"
-+ngx_module_deps="$ngx_addon_dir/src/ddebug.h $ngx_addon_dir/src/ngx_http_xss_filter_module.h $ngx_addon_dir/src/ngx_http_xss_util.h"
-+
-+. auto/module